    Front Panel IMPORTANT: The 2 SFP ports labeled 17S ~ 18S are associated with the 2 RJ-45 ports labeled 17T ~ 18T respectively. When one of the two associated ports is used, the other port will not work. For example, if the Gigabit SFP port labeled 17S is used, the Gigabit RJ-45 port labeled 17T will not function.

    Loading Default Setting If for any reason the device is not responding properly, you can reset it to its factory default settings either directly on the device or through its Web interface. Hardware 1. Turn on the switch. 2. Press and hold the Reset button on the front panel of the switch for 5 seconds until all the LED start blinking.

    Updating Firmware 1. Select System Config > Firmware update > HTTP Upgrade. This page appears. 2. Click Select File to select the firmware file. 3. Click Apply. The upgrade process starts. 4. After the firmware is successfully upgraded, the system will automatically log out and reboot.
